There Are Two Versions of Halo 4 on iTunes. You Don’t Want Either of Them.

Kotaku - Loaded with official artwork from the Xbox 360 hit and padded with dozens of glowing reviews, the two Halo 4 games that made it through Apple's strict app approval process this week are, quite obviously, not what they claim to be. (Halo 4, iPad, iPhone)
